Didier Drogba Chelsea win Spear


Didier Drogba injured as Chelsea crushed waist Blackpool 3-1 after colliding with striker James Beattie.

Chelsea earned full points when they travel to the headquarters of Blackpool, Bloomfield Road on Tuesday morning pm, March 8, 2011. Frank Lampard managed to become the star of the Blues victory by scoring two goals.

55 World Player of the Year Nomination

55 World Player of the Year Nomination
Here's a list of 55 players

Goalkeepers: Gianluigi Buffon, Iker Casillas, Petr Cech, Julio Cesar, Edwin van der Sar

Defenders: Daniel Alves, Gareth Bale, Michel Bastos, Ashley Cole, Patrice Evra, Rio Ferdinand, Philipp Lahm, Lucio, Maicon, Marcelo, Alessandro Nesta, Pepe, Gerard Pique, Carles Puyol, Sergio Ramos, Walter Samuel, John Terry, Thiago Silva, Nemanja Vidic, Javier Zanetti

Midfielders: Esteban Cambiasso, Michael Essien, Cesc Fabregas, Steven Gerrard, Andres Iniesta, Kaka, Frank Lampard, Javier Mascherano, Thomas Muller, Mesut Ozil, Andrea Pirlo, Bastian Schweinsteiger, Wesley Sneijder, Xabi Alonso, Xavi

Striker: Dimitar Berbatov, Didier Drogba, Samuel Eto'o, Diego Forlan, Gonzalo Higuain, Zlatan Ibrahimovi, Lionel Messi, Diego Milito, Arjen Robben, Ronaldinho, Cristiano Ronaldo, Wayne Rooney, Carlos Tevez, Fernando Torres, David Villa
